Transaction cca939159059a3900dda94e4b77409b06247dd4882b7c42ab06dd6695afd7a17
1 Input
1 Output
-
cca939159059a3900dda94e4b77409b06247dd4882b7c42ab06dd6695afd7a17:0
- value
- 40544330
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 03ad1863a572912ffe7a889cbdbfe8dca936da58 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LSPSrSBHcfFoSgPuhUasGLezSUojqbvx